Fall 2022
Course Title Credits
CS 152L Computer Programming Fundamentals 3
ENGL 1120 Composition 2 3
GEOL 1110 Physical Geology 3
GEOL 1110L Physical Geology Lab 1
GRMN 1110 German 1 3
Math 1250 Trigonometry & Pre-Calculus 5
(18)
Spring 2023
Course Title Credits
CS 241L Data Organization 3
CS 251L Intermediate Programming 3
CS 293 Social and Ethical Issues in Computing 1
ECE 238L Computer Logic Design 4
ENGL 2210 Professional and Technical Communication 3
GEOL 1165 People and Place 3
MATH 1512 Calculus 1 4
(21)
Summer 2023
Course Title Credits
ARCH 1120 Intro to Architecture 3
ENVS 1130 The Blue Planet 3
(6)
Fall 2023
Course Title Credits
CS 261 Maht Foundations of Computer Science 3
CS 351L Design of Large Programs 4
CS 499 Individual Study - UNM EPICS Progarm 3
CS 499 Individual Study - SC23 Student Cluster Competition 3
HNRS 1120 Legacy of Ancient Greece 3
MATH 1522 Calculus 2 (CNM) 4
(20)
Spring 2024
Course Title Credits
CS 357L Declarative Programming 3
CS 361L Data Structures and Algorithms 3
CS 591 ST: High Performance Computing (Grad lvl) 3
MATH 2531 Calculus 3 4
MATH 306 College Geometry 3
MATH 356 Symbolic Logic (Grad lvl) 4
(20)
Summer 2024
Course Title Credits
MATH 314 Linear Algebra with Applications (ASU) 3
STAT 345 Elements fo Math Statistics and Probability 3
PHYS 1310 Calculus-Based Physics 1 (ASU) 3
(9)
Fall 2024
Course Title Credits
CS 341L Intro to Computer Architecture and Organization 3
CS 561 Data Structures and Algorithms (Grad lvl) 3
CS 460 Software Engineering 3
CS 481 Computer Operating Systems 3
GEOL 2110C Historical Geology 4
MATH 375 Introduction to Numerical Computing 3
CS 551 SC24 Student Cluster Competition 3
(In Progress) (22)
Total (inc. transfer) 144